作 者:王莹[1] 王奇政 陈永晔 狄爱辉 张艳[1] WANG Ying;WANG Qizheng;CHEN Yongye;DI Aihui;ZHANG Yan(Department of Radiology,Peking University Third Hospital,Beijing 100191,China)
出 处:《中国医学计算机成像杂志》2022年第4期433-438,共6页Chinese Computed Medical Imaging
摘 要:目的:使用宽体探测器高分辨率CT对冠状动脉支架进行成像,并进行4种不同重建方式的重建,评估经皮冠状动脉介入治疗(PCI)术后患者腔内支架的可视化程度。方法:对连续的37例PCI术后患者,使用宽体探测器高分辨率CT行冠状动脉CT血管成像(CTA),采用高清扫描模式,并用4种不同重建算法进行图像重建,包括标准(stnd)算法,细节(detail)算法、高清标准(HD-stnd)和高清细节(HD-detail)算法,对植入支架血管进行图像后处理,获得血管拉直图像以及相应部位的血管垂直横断面图像,对图像进行客观评价(包括支架后冠脉内腔直径、噪声、晕状伪影)和主观图像质量评分(Likert4级评分法),结果采用重复测量方差分析进行比较,P<0.05为差异具有统计学意义。结果:使用HD-detail和HD-stnd重建算法图像的测量支架后冠脉内腔直径均大于其他重建算法,HD-detail和HD-stnd重建算法图像的晕状伪影均小于其他重建算法,HD-detail重建算法图像的噪声最大,HD-detail和HD-stnd重建算法主观图像质量评分高于其他重建算法,差异具有统计学意义(P<0.05)。结论:采用宽体探测器高分辨率CT结合高分辨率扫描模式对冠状动脉支架进行成像,并使用高清重建(HD-detail和HD-stnd)算法,能够提高冠状动脉支架内管腔情况的可视化程度,为PCI术后患者的随访观察提供更加精准的依据。Purpose:To evaluate the visualization of coronary stents with four different reconstruction algorithms in the whole-organ high-definition CT scanner.Methods:Thirty-seven patients after stenting underwent coronary computed tomography angiography(CTA)with high-definition scanning mode in a whole-organ high-definition CT scanner.Four different reconstruction algorithms(stnd,detail,HD-stnd,HD-detail)were applied to reconstruct the images of the stented coronary artery.The objective image quality score included the intrastent luminal diameter,noise and blooming artifact,and the Likert 4 point scale was performed to evaluate subjective image quality score.Differences of objective and subjective parameters of different reconstruction algorithms were compared by repeated measurement variance analysis,P-value<0.05 was considered statistically significant.Results:The intrastent luminal diameter using HD-detail and HD-stnd was larger than the other reconstruction algorithms.The blooming artifact of the images using HD-detail and HD-stnd were smaller than that of other reconstruction algorithms.The noise of the images using HD-detail was the largest.The subjective image quality score using HD-detail and HD-stnd was larger than the other reconstruction algorithms.The difference was with statistical significance(P<0.05).Conclusions:The whole-organ high-definition CT scanner can be used to improve the visualization of coronary stents by the highdefinition scanning mode with HD-detail and HD-stnd reconstruction algorithms,and provide more accurate basis for follow-up observation of patients after PCI.
关 键 词:冠状动脉支架 宽体探测器 高分辨率CT 高清重建算法
